    Sub: RGUKT - Basar, UG Admissions 2024 - Call Letter for certificate verification - reg.
    All the candidates are requested to read them carefully.
    I. Candidates are instructed to report at Venue of certificate verification i.e., at RGUKT, Basar
    Campus, Basar Nirmal (District), Telangana as per below schedule by following provisional
    selection list published on the website.
    Day 1: On 8th July 2024 at 09:00 AM: S.No. 1 to 500 from the selection list
    Day 2: On 9th July 2024 at 09:00 AM: S.No. 501 to 1000 from the selection list
    Day 3: On 10th July 2024 at 09:00 AM: S.No. 1001 to 1404 from the selection list
    It is the responsibility of the students/parents to make all suitable travel arrangements so
    as to reach the University by 09.00 AM on the above said date(s).
    Admission shall not be given, if the student fails to attend the certificate verification in
    person on the above date and time for whatsoever reason. The seat may be allocated to
    the next candidate based on merit.
    II. Mere attending the certificate verification does not guarantee a seat. The admission will
    be given only if the candidate fulfills all the eligibility criteria and pay the relevant fee after
    the verification of all original certificates / documents. The selection stands cancelled in
    case candidate fails to produce the prescribed original certificates at the time of
    verification or fails to pay the relevant fee.
    III. Documents to be carried:
    The candidate is supposed to bring the following documents /certificates in original along
    with Two Sets of the Xerox copies.
    1. Grade Sheet (Memo) of 10th Class Board Examination.
    2. Transfer Certificate (from Institution last attended)
    3. Study/ Bonafide certificates (from 4th class to 10th Class)
    4. Caste (SC/ST/OBC)/ EWS (EWS issued after 01-04-2024) by the competent authority
    (Meeseva Only).
    5. Income Certificate/EBC Certificate (latest and issued after 01.04.2024 from Meeseva Only).
    6. Provide six photos of the candidate and two photographs of any three family members
    (Father, Mother, guardian1 and guardian2) for the parent ID card provided for outings.
    7. A photo copy (Xerox copy) of Aadhar Card.
    8. Candidates claiming admission under Non-local Category have to submit a Residence
    Certificate as a proof to effect that the candidate have resided in the state for a total
    period of 10 years excluding periods of study outside the state or either of whose
    parents have resided in the state for a total period of 10 years excluding period of
    employment outside the state.
    9. The candidates who wish to avail bank loan shall bring the following documents (The
    loan applications will be available at the bank in the campus)
    a. Additional four sets of copies of the above certificates.
    b. Employee Identity Card of the parent.
    c. Three months salary Certificates of the parent (Latest).
    d. PAN card of Student and Parent.
    e. Ration Card / PAN Card / Voter ID card /Aadhar Card of the Student and Parent.
    f. Bank account statement for last six months.
    g. Six photographs of the candidate and four photographs of the Parent/Guardian.
    Note1: Students who are eligible for fee reimbursement as per the stipulated Telangana
    State Government rules need not pay tuition fee of Rs. 36,000/- whose parental
    annual income is specified below for eligibility of scholarship.
    i. SC and ST welfare students whose annual family income is Rs 2 lakh or below
    ii. BC and EBC and Minority welfare students who belong to rural area their
    family income should be 1.5 lakh or below.
    iii. BC and EBC and Minority welfare students who belong to urban area their
    family income should be 2 lakh or below.
    iv. Disable welfare students whose parental income is 1 Lakh or below
    In case, if the students do not reimburse the tuition fee, they have to pay the
    tuition fee before the commencement of second semester examination in the
    academic year in order to permit them to appear in the exam
    Note2: It has been found for the past few years that the fee reimbursed by the
    Government is not exactly same as the fee prescribed by the University. An
    average of Rs. 30,000 is being sanctioned by the Government per year per
    student. Hence, the students who are eligible for fee reimbursement as per the
    stipulated State Government rules shall pay the difference amount between
    tuition fee and the amount of scholarship that is being sanctioned which would
    be around Rs. 6,000 at the time of admission.
    Note4: All the Candidates who have been selected under Local area as Andhra Pradesh
    need to pay the total Fee of Rs. 40,700/- for Non-SC/ST Categories and Rs.
    40,200/- for SC/ST Categories and it will be refunded by RGUKT as and when the
    scholarship is sanctioned from the respective state.
